Night mode

Critical Role Season 2 Episode 63

Episode Title: Intervention
Countries: ,
Airing Date: May 16, 2019
Runtime:240 min
IMDb Rating:

Watch Critical Role Season 2 Episode 63 full movie online free in HD with English subtitles – no download needed.

The Mighty Nein tell the Bright Queen about a potential attack on Xhorhas, and attempt to infiltrate a meeting at the Overcrow Apothecary...Â